Cron daemon logs
Hi. I keep getting this messages on my root account. I don't know what
causes them, but they are extremely annoying:
On an hourly basis:
Date: Fri, 12 Feb 1999 17:01:00 GMT
From: Cron Daemon <root@tralala.com>
To: root@tralala.com
Subject: Cron <root@tralala> run-parts /etc/cron.hourly
Couldnt get a file descriptor referring to the console
stty: standard input: Invalid argument
On a daily basis:
Subject: Cron <root@tralala> run-parts /etc/cron.daily
Couldnt get a file descriptor referring to the console
stty: standard input: Invalid argument
And, for a change, on a weekly basis:
Subject: Cron <root@tralala> run-parts /etc/cron.weekly
Read file error: ./slogin.1 No such file or directory
This is a Red Hat 5.1 system.
I have modified some things, but can't recall touching the cron
configuration.
Any diagnosis/solutions are welcome.
